Tips & Limitations
- Prioritize Data: The accuracy of your output depends on the quality of your activity data. Always prioritize primary data over secondary spend-based estimations for Scope 3.
- No Greenwashing: This skill is programmed to reject platitudes. If you ask for a sustainability statement, be prepared to provide evidence-backed metrics.
- Context is Key: Always define your industry and regional regulatory context (e.g., EU vs. US markets) to receive the most relevant framework advice. The playbook is designed for strategic guidance, not as a legal substitute; always verify disclosure requirements with your internal compliance or legal teams.
